Subject: [PATCH v5 16/27] compiler: Option to add PROVIDE_HIDDEN replacement for weak symbols

Provide an option to have a PROVIDE_HIDDEN (linker script) entry for
each weak symbol. This option solves an error in x86_64 where the linker
optimizes PIE generated code to be non-PIE because --emit-relocs was used
instead of -pie (to reduce dynamic relocations).

init/Kconfig | 7 +++++++
scripts/link-vmlinux.sh | 14 ++++++++++++++
2 files changed, 21 insertions(+)
diff --git a/init/Kconfig b/init/Kconfig
index d4f90cc38ede..2d7431a8b108 100644
--- a/init/Kconfig
+++ b/init/Kconfig
@@ -1974,6 +1974,13 @@ config ASN1
inform it as to what tags are to be expected in a stream and what
functions to call on what tags.
+config WEAK_PROVIDE_HIDDEN
+ bool
+ help
+ Generate linker script PROVIDE_HIDDEN entries for all weak symbols. It
+ allows to prevent non-PIE code being replaced by the linker if the
+ emit-relocs option is used instead of PIE (useful for x86_64 PIE).
+
source "kernel/Kconfig.locks"
config ARCH_HAS_SYNC_CORE_BEFORE_USERMODE
diff --git a/scripts/link-vmlinux.sh b/scripts/link-vmlinux.sh
index 4bf811c09f59..f5d31119b9d7 100755
--- a/scripts/link-vmlinux.sh
+++ b/scripts/link-vmlinux.sh
@@ -142,6 +142,17 @@ kallsyms()
${CC} ${aflags} -c -o ${2} ${afile}
}
+gen_weak_provide_hidden()
+{
+ if [ -n "${CONFIG_WEAK_PROVIDE_HIDDEN}" ]; then
+ local pattern="s/^\s\+ w \(\w\+\)$/PROVIDE_HIDDEN(\1 = .);/gp"
+ echo -e "SECTIONS {\n. = _end;" > .tmp_vmlinux_hiddenld
+ ${NM} ${1} | sed -n "${pattern}" >> .tmp_vmlinux_hiddenld
+ echo "}" >> .tmp_vmlinux_hiddenld
+ LDFLAGS_vmlinux="${LDFLAGS_vmlinux} -T .tmp_vmlinux_hiddenld"
+ fi
+}
+
# Create map file with all symbols from ${1}
# See mksymap for additional details
mksysmap()
@@ -226,6 +237,9 @@ modpost_link vmlinux.o
# modpost vmlinux.o to check for section mismatches
${MAKE} -f "${srctree}/scripts/Makefile.modpost" vmlinux.o
+# Generate weak linker script
+gen_weak_provide_hidden vmlinux.o
+
kallsymso=""
kallsyms_vmlinux=""
if [ -n "${CONFIG_KALLSYMS}" ]; then
